BENJAMIN H. COOKE
BRACEY, Va. - Benjamin Herbert Cooke, 78, formerly of Franklin County, died Friday, Jan. 12, 2007 in Community Memorial Health Center. A funeral service was conducted Monday, Jan. 15, at Crowder-Hite-Crews Funeral Home and Crematory in South Hill, Va., with interment in Shiloh United Methodist Church cemetery in South Hill.

Mr. Cooke was a former funeral director with Bright Funeral Home in Wake Forest. He was a retired FBI special agent and a Korean Army veteran. He was predeceased by two wives, Joan Brown Cooke and Forrest M. Cooke.

Surviving: son, David W. Cooke (Ellen) of South Hill, Va.; daughter, Sarah Ann Imler (Tom) of Clayton; and four grandchildren.
